Target shoppers could receive $1,711+ after retailer agrees to $2.2 million transparency settlement
Target will pay over $1,700 to eligible individuals due to a class action lawsuit alleging failure to disclose salary ranges in Washington job postings. The settlement resolves claims that Target violated state law by not providing this information.

Here’s what affected applicants need to know.
Who qualifies for the Target settlement?
The lawsuit centered on job listings in Washington that allegedly did not disclose wages, salary ranges, or a general description of other compensation and benefits, as required under state law.To qualify, you must have applied for a Target Corp. job in Washington between January 1, 2023, and July 26, 2025. The job posting must not have included pay details or a general description of compensation or benefits.
Plaintiffs argued they would not have applied for positions had they known the true salary ranges and wage scales.
How do you file a claim and meet deadlines?
Class members must submit a valid claim form by March 31 to receive payment. Claims may be submitted online utilizing the Notice ID and PIN provided in the dispatched settlement notice.
In the absence of that information, applicants may reach out to the settlement administrator via email at info@EPOASettlement-Jan-02-2026.com or by telephone at (833) 647-9003 to request their ID and PIN once more. They must furnish their complete name and address, as cited in a report by The US Sun.
A conclusive approval hearing is set for May 5. Should the court ascertain that the agreement is equitable and just, disbursements will commence subsequent to that date, as stated in a report by The US Sun.

How much money could class members receive?
Eligible class members will receive an equal share of the net settlement fund according to the settlement terms. The ultimate sum is contingent upon the number of legitimate claims submitted.Claimants are assured a minimum disbursement of $1,711.93, as quoted in a report by The US Sun.
Individuals who received a settlement notification via mail can locate an estimated payment amount on their claim form. As the payments are categorized as non-wage damages, recipients may also obtain a 1099 form for taxation purposes, as quoted in a report by The US Sun.
